You'll sign a purchase agreement to continue with the sale. It will contain your information and how you'd like the deed to be assigned, to you or joint ownership etc.
What probably happened is the seller did not pay his maintenance fees for 2017. The $10 is a late fee. I don't think Sean can force an owner to pay the maintenance fees if he doesn't want to. But the details of the sale should have been listed in the auction description. If not, make sure you understand the fees written in the estoppel.

Asking the seller or broker for the deed would not be a normal practice. You can get it yourself from most counties otherwise let the closing company do their job. Any legitimate closing company will not prepare a deed without a copy of the existing.

Take a usage estoppel with a grain of salt. Any owner can take usage after that estoppel is prepared. This is why it's important to buy from a known seller that will make it right if it ends up being different than stated in the contract. I don't even bother asking for an estoppel.

National Harbor takes longer than any other Wyndham deed only because the deed has to be mailed in so your at the mercy of the county and then once you receive it back it has to be sent to Wyndham which is taking them around 3 months to update the account for whatever reason.
